Output 3ce0517ba53221ae76a7021f2c7c1772cbfca72128a29d81fc4cbac7346eae09:1

value
357906200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2381b0717f80fe9f34651bcad59c3ad9b6850934 OP_EQUAL
address
MB8uF7LUWfbdbEBkMavtviQywe4wV5MCqb
transaction
3ce0517ba53221ae76a7021f2c7c1772cbfca72128a29d81fc4cbac7346eae09
spent
true